"Home of the Mission Burrito" so we had to check it out.AMBIANCE:Parking: Welcome to the City. Parking is limited but there's 15 minute parking if you're looking for a grab and go.Seating: Inside seating for maybe about 6 groups, 20 people. Vibes: You're in the Heart of San Fran so you're surrounded by a lot of eclectic culture from art and presentations of houses and restaurants. It's a grit and grind place so don't expect anything too flashy. The place itself is pretty neat. I dig the 80's lite rock music, very Frisco feeling. A spacious place filled with history from the art or previous articles written about this place. Great for a quick grab and go or if you just wanna casually sit and enjoy the history of The City.FOOD:Mission (Super) Burrito (Recommend)You have two choices of meats and we got the steak and al pastor. The meats were flavorful and savory. Mix that in with the guacamole, black beans, salsa, cheese, and lettuce, you're in for a fulfilling delight. It took me two sittings to finish.CUSTOMER SERVICE:Solid! Professional staff that was helpful with our order!TL; DR OVERALL:4 Stars. Good prices, selections, food, and just a solid experience. There are a lot of burrito places but it's unique to be at the "home" of the Mission Burrito. There's more dishes to explore here, so if you're in the area, do give this spot a try.TIPS:* Try their sun-dried tomato tortilla

This place is supposedly the home of the burrito which is what piqued my interest. I was happy to see that they had carnitas on the menu as well as some other options that you normally don't see in this type of Mexican food establishment. The choices of meats and even tortillas plus other options were plentiful which really gave a nice customization to what we were eating. The carnitas were moist and tasted as if it was actually slow cooked versus cooked quickly, like many restaurants do. I honestly kind of expected the burrito to be even bigger than it was as it was a standard size burrito which filled me up. They have three sauces, one of which was a creamy red, then a spicy red and a green avocado salsa. All three were good but the spicy red was by far my favorite.They did have some agua fresca's too as well as beer and bottled Mexican Coke which is the best choice with this kind of meal. If I lived in the area this would probably be a regular place for me.
